This was a phase III, 24-week, randomised, double-blind, double-dummy, Multinational (China, South Korea, Taiwan), Multicentre, 2-arm parallel-group, active-controlled study in patients with COPD.
The study was designed to demonstrate the superiority of CHF 5993 pMDI over budesonide/formoterol in terms of pulmonary function (change from baseline in pre-dose morning FEV1 and 2-hour post-dose morning FEV1 at Week 24), both in the overall study population and in the Chinese population. The study lasted approximately 27 weeks for each patient, and a total of 7 clinic visits (Visit [V] 0 to V6) were performed during the study, plus a follow-up phone call.
A pre-screening visit (Visit [V] 0) was planned to occur no more than 7 days before a screening visit (V1, Week -2), followed by a 2-week open-label run-in period on Symbicort® Turbuhaler® (budesonide/formoterol fumarate [FF] 160/4.5 μg per inhalation), 2 inhalations twice daily (BID) (total daily dose: 640/18 μg budesonide/FF). The 2-week run-in period was deemed sufficient in order to 'standardise' the target population on the same treatment (Symbicort® Turbuhaler® [budesonide/FF 160/4.5 μg per inhalation]) prior to randomisation to study treatments, without leading to a deterioration in the disease.
At the randomisation visit (V2, Week 0), patients were randomised in a 1:1 ratio to one of the following two treatments for 24 weeks:
- CHF 5993 pMDI, 2 inhalations BID (total daily dose: 400/24/50 μg beclometasone dipropionate [BDP]/FF/glycopyrronium bromide [GB]);
- Symbicort® Turbuhaler®, 2 inhalations BID (total daily dose: 640/18 μg budesonide/FF).
The length of the treatment period (24 weeks) was considered as adequate to evaluate the long-term efficacy and safety of CHF 5993 pMDI 100/6/12.5 μg versus (vs) budesonide/formoterol in terms of lung function.
Salbutamol was purchased locally by the vendor and used as rescue medication on an as-needed basis during both the run-in and treatment periods.
Four subsequent visits were performed after 4 weeks (V3), 12 weeks (V4), 18 weeks (V5), and 24 weeks (V6) of treatment. A time window of ±3 days was allowed for the visit dates from V2 to V6. An early termination (ET) visit was to be performed in the event of premature study discontinuation, during which all efforts were made to perform the assessments that should have been done at Week 24 (V6). A safety follow-up phone call was scheduled with the patient 7-10 days after last study treatment intake or ET visit in order to check the status of any unresolved adverse events (AEs) at the last visit.
Following the outbreak of the coronavirus disease-19 (COVID-19) pandemic the conduct of the study was adapted to ensure the safety of the patients and staff as well as the study continuity (see Section 9.8.1.2). Sites were instructed that patient retention was privileged with continuity of investigational drug supply. As emergency measures, it was authorised to postpone planned patients' visits or conduct remote visits and have the investigational product delivered to patients' home. Specific process for performing and reporting of Remote Visits was followed to cover all remote visits conducted during the period of the COVID-19 outbreak.
Study assessments
During the study, from screening (V1, Week -2) to end of treatment (V6, Week 24):
- Concomitant medications, smoking status, AEs, and physical examination were recorded at all visits. Height and weight were measured at V1 (Week -2);
- Pregnancy tests (serum tests at V1 [Week -2] and V6 [Week 24], and urinary tests from V1 [Week -2] to V5 [Week 18]) were performed. Blood samples for haematology and blood chemistry were performed at V1 (Week -2), V4 (Week 12), V5 (Week 18), and V6 (Week 24);
- Vital signs (blood pressure) were recorded pre-bronchodilator at V1 (Week -2), and at pre-dose and 10 minutes (mins) post-dose at all visits from V2 (Week 0) to V6 (Week 24);
- A single 12-lead electrocardiogram (ECG) was recorded pre-bronchodilator at V1 (Week -2), triplicate 12-lead ECG was recorded pre-dose at V2 (Week 0), and single 12-lead ECGs were recorded post-dose at V2 (Week 0), and pre-dose and 10 mins post-dose at V4 (Week 12) and V6 (Week 24);
- COPD exacerbations were assessed by the Investigator at all visits; the COPD assessment test (CAT) was also completed at all visits;
- Lung function tests were carried out to assess FEV1, forced vital capacity (FVC), forced expiratory flow measured between 25% and 75% of a forced vital capacity (FEF25-75%), and inspiratory capacity (IC) pre-bronchodilator at V1 (Week -2) and pre-dose from V2 (Week 0) to V6 (Week 24). FEV1 and FVC were assessed 10-15 mins post-bronchodilator at V1 (Week -2) and 2 hours post-dose from V2 (Week 0) to V6 (Week 24);
- The patient diary was completed daily from V1 (Week -2) until the end of treatment (V6, Week 24) to record medication intake, including study treatment and rescue medication, and treatment compliance;
- The European Quality of Life-5-Dimensional-3-Level questionnaire (EQ-5D-3L) and St. George's Respiratory Questionnaire (SGRQ) were completed at V2 (Week 0), V4 (Week 12), and V6 (Week 24). Additionally, the health economic assessment was completed from V2 (Week 0) to V6 (Week 24).
The final analysis included a total of 1053 screened patients and 708 randomised patients (353 patients received CHF 5993 pMDI and 355 patients received budesonide/formoterol). This included 826 patients screened in China of whom 578 patients were randomised to one of two treatments: CHF 5993 pMDI (288 patients) and budesonide/formoterol (290 patients). Overall there were 612 evaluable patients, including 506 evaluable patients in China. Of the 708 randomised patients, 706 patients were included in the Intention-to-treat (ITT) population (CHF 5993 pMDI: n=351; budesonide/formoterol: n=355).
